Property Description

Two adjoining waterfront lots, totaling 0.743 acres ( 0.533 acres and 0.21 acres respectively ) on the shores of Walters Cove, on Walters Island, west of the entrance to Kyuquot Sound. Stones throw away from the government dock & local store
